Inge Kaete Schlenk, 90, died on Jan. 1, 2012, at Jefferson’s Ferry Retirement Community in South Setauket, N.Y., where she lived since 2007.

Inge was born in Bremen, Germany, on March 8, 1921, to Emil and Gertrud (Brockmann) Schier. She married Hermann Schlenk (born in Jena Germany) in 1946, and after briefly living in Wurtzburg, they immigrated to the USA where they became citizens. When Hermann’s career in biochemistry brought him to the Hormel Institute of the University of Minnesota, they ultimately settled in Austin in 1953.

Inge’s passions included flowers and gardening, music, literature, art, interior decorating and bridge. She also had training and great talent in cooking, baking and sewing. Her love of reading led her to work in a bookstore in Bremen and at the Austin Public Library. As a volunteer, she was a driver and president of the local Meals on Wheels. She was a unitarian with broad interests and high energy, was always proud of her family and a lover of dogs, the outdoors and swimming. She greatly enjoyed travel and time at the family cabin on Rice Lake in Lake Mills, Iowa.

She is preceded in death by her parents; brother, Heinz; husband, Hermann (2003).

Inge is survived by her son, Thomas Schlenk, Austin; daughter, Cornelia Schlenk and son-in-law, Joseph (Jay) Tanski, of Setauket, N.Y.; several nieces and nephews.
